The AC Servo Driver Pulscale, model PGC-011 E4305502001 by Futaba Corp., is a precision control device used in industrial applications to drive and control the motion of AC servo motors. This unit is designed to accurately and dynamically control the speed and position of servo motors, providing superior performance in automated systems. Key features of the AC Servo Driver Pulscale include precise speed and position control, high pulse resolution, and various advanced control modes. It is capable of interfacing with various feedback devices to ensure accurate motor feedback. Common failures in the AC Servo Driver Pulscale may include issues with power supply components, damaged control circuitry, or faults in the interface circuits. Overheating due to inadequate cooling or electrical surges can also lead to failure in this device. Regular maintenance and monitoring of performance parameters are recommended to prevent potential failures and ensure the longevity of the unit.

The Futaba Corp. EDTFA-00ES clamp is a device used for measuring electrical current flowing through a conductor without the need for physical contact. It typically features a clamping mechanism that allows it to be attached to the conductor, a sensor for detecting the magnetic field generated by the current, and an output signal for displaying the current value. Common failures in clamps like this can be due to sensor malfunctions, calibration issues, or damage to the clamping mechanism. Regular maintenance and calibration checks are recommended to ensure accurate and reliable operation.
